Treku Conference Table Aise

Conference tables for focused collaboration

The Treku Aise collection brings a consistent, practical look to meeting rooms, team spaces and shared office settings. These rectangular conference tables are designed for seated collaboration, with a fixed height of 74 cm and widths that support different room layouts.

Depending on the model, Aise tables accommodate four or six people. Their 90 cm depth gives participants a defined work surface while keeping the table suitable for structured meetings, workshops and everyday team discussions.

Choose the Aise base and top combination

The family includes tables with four wooden legs, two wooden legs or two angled metal legs. This lets you choose between a warmer all-wood appearance and a more contrasting frame, while retaining the straightforward rectangular format of the collection.

Wood and oak table-top finishes are paired with a broad selection of surface and base colors, including natural wood tones, black, grey, beige and additional accent options. The tables are suitable for a cable tray, although a cable tray is not included.

Where Treku Aise tables work well

Treku Aise conference tables suit offices that need a dependable meeting surface without introducing height adjustment or complex controls. Use the collection in formal conference rooms, smaller meeting areas, project rooms and open-plan collaboration zones. The 160 cm and 180 cm examples in the range can help organize different room sizes, while the available collection widths extend from 140 to 220 cm.

Because the tables have a fixed 74 cm height, they are intended for conventional seated use rather than sit-stand working. Their rectangular tops make it easy to position chairs along the long sides and at the ends, supporting face-to-face meetings and group work.

How to choose between the models

Compare the base design

Select the four-leg wooden version when you want a stable, coordinated wood look. The two-leg wooden designs offer a simpler visual structure, while the model with angled metal legs adds a more graphic contrast between the oak top and its frame. Base materials in the family include wood, metal and steel, with several base colors available.

Check capacity and dimensions

Start with the number of people you need to seat, then measure the room and circulation space around the table. The collection includes options listed for four or six people, with a 90 cm depth and examples measuring 160 or 180 cm wide. Other listed widths range from 140 to 220 cm, so confirm the exact dimensions of the selected model before planning the room.

Review finishes and cable planning

Use the table-top finish to set the tone of the room. Oak and wood surfaces can support a warmer office scheme, while beige, black, brown and grey options provide more neutral alternatives. Base colors include black, grey, beige, blue, brown, green, orange, pink, red, white, wood, yellow and silver, depending on the configuration.

If meetings involve laptops or shared equipment, check the route for power and data before ordering. Aise tables are suitable for a cable tray, but the tray is not included, so cable management should be planned as a separate requirement.
